My devotions on Tuesday morning were pretty sweet, and I especially loved my reading in Exodus 33:11 and Exodus 33:13.
I’m sure our recent fast caused this to jump off the page at me, but verse 11′s description of Joshua not being willing to depart from the place of intimacy with the Lord sure spoke to me. How many times are we in such a hurry to get on to the next item on our ‘To Do” list, that we miss those times of just lingering in HIS Presence? I pray that you will find some unhurried moments to just linger with Him, ala 2Corinthians 3:18.
But then verse 13 is what really got me. I’m using the Amplified Bible for my devotions this year, and the way it expands on the meaning of ‘knowing’ the Lord speaks to me: “that I may know You [progressively become more deeply and intimately acquainted with You, perceiving and recognizing and understanding more strongly and clearly]“
Progressively. Not stuck in a rut. Not staying the same. Not a hum-drum, go thru the motions kind of relationship. No!
Deeper! More intimate! With greater perception! With clearer understanding!
I’m not Moses, but that’s what I want! The fast may be over, but the pursuit isn’t!
